## Environment Variables — LockerFlow Access Service

LockerFlow mediates badge taps at the laundry-locker banks in the Marwick residence towers. Each variable below is read once at startup; changes require a restart. `LOCKER_GRID_URL` points at the hardware gateway, `UNLOCK_TIMEOUT_MS` bounds how long a door stays released, and `AUDIT_SINK` names the event stream for every open attempt. All three are safe to commit to the sample file. The remaining entry sets the gateway signing secret, and it appears on the following line.

env line for fafof-fahag: LEDGER_TOKEN5=f8790

Quick note for assistants staffing the Fennelgate pop-up stand at the Marrowfield Expo: visitors are welcome in the front lounge, but the back prep area is staff-only — snacks, demo kits, and the spare tablets live there. Keep the curtain closed when you can. To unlock the prep-area door, punch in the code below.

badge for fafop-fajof: bdg-Z-47

## Provenance: Search relevance tuning (Quarrelwood)

Hey reviewer — the relevance weights in this change were generated by the Quarrelwood tuning job, not hand-edited, so please don't nitpick individual values. The job's config is checked in; rerunning it should reproduce the weights exactly. To confirm you're reviewing the right run, match against the token below.

trace token, kahog-tajeg: htk6_97d963

Wavelet renders waveform previews for the Tinderbox media library. Pipeline: upload → decode worker → peak extraction → cached PNG strips. Workers run in the Saltmere pool, stateless, autoscaled. Known issues: long files over two hours get chunked; chunk stitching occasionally drops the final segment — fix in flight. Dashboards live under the Wavelet folder. On-call owns requeues. Cold-start of the peak cache after a wipe requires authenticating to the restore endpoint with the recovery passphrase below.

vault phrase of tajeg-tageg = pelix-druix-holius-briael-zorwyn-frawyn-fraox-norok-drueth-aldiel